President Rashid Strongly Condemns the Holy Quran and Iraqi Flag Burning in Sweden

The official website of the Iraqi Presidency published a statement condemning the burning of the holy Quran and the Iraqi flag in Sweden.
The full statement is as follows:
The President of the Republic of Iraq, Abdullatif Jamal Rashid strongly condemns the irresponsible act of granting permission for extremists to burn copies of the Holy Quran and the Iraqi flag once again.
In addition, he is amazed at how the Swedish government, despite respecting people's faiths and religions, does not act as it should.
As a result, the problem is further complicated, and popular anger is exacerbated when violations occur that must be prevented and brought to an end.
Both directly and through diplomatic channels, the President expressed his concern and warned the Swedish authorities to respect Muslim sensibilities and refrain from such deviant behavior.
Furthermore, he reiterated that the Kingdom of Sweden should consider and act responsibly on this matter, taking into account that Muslim sensibilities throughout the world should be respected, as well as Islamic sanctities that should not be insulted. Insofar as they respect the sensibilities and sanctities of every human on this planet, as well as their right to believe and practice their faith.
Amidst these circumstances, President Rashid reaffirmed that the government's responsibility is to protect human rights and guarantee the freedom of expression in a peaceful manner to protest peacefully against what is going on.
A consideration of the country's responsibilities in maintaining diplomatic traditions and adhering to international norms and laws must be taken into account, he added.
